Meat Cattle livestock numbers in Russia increased by 1.3%

Over nine months of 2019 cattle livestock inventories for slaughter in live weight in all types of facilities accounted 1705.5 thousand Mt, RF Agricultural Ministry reports.

The number grew 1.3 % or 21.2 thousand Mt. Overall beef production of meat and interbreed cattle increased by 8.1 % or 315.4 thousand Mt.

Agricultural enterprises ramped up meat production by 15.1 thousand Mt (+2.1%) to 724.6 thousand Mt, production in peasant-based agriculture (farm) facilities was 10.5 thousand Mt (+6.3%) up to 176.0 thousand Mt.

As of October 1, 2019, meat and interbreed cattle livestock in all types of farming entities accounted 3959.6 thousand head. This is 110.8 thousand head (2.9%) up y-o-y. It’s expected that high quality beef production in the future will be growing at the cost of development of the meat cattle breeding.
